The Technical Process: How We Tackle Sprinkler System Water Damage

Dealing with sprinkler system water damage requires more than just mopping up puddles. It’s a science. Improper drying can leave behind moisture trapped in materials, leading to mold and structural rot. Our process is designed to address the root cause and thoroughly dry your home, using specialized equipment and protocols. We’ve seen what happens when shortcuts are taken, and that’s why our meticulous approach is crucial for your property’s recovery. We’re committed to thorough water removal and drying.

1. Immediate Water Extraction

The first step is always swift water removal. We deploy industrial-grade pumps and extractors to remove standing water from your floors and affected areas. This is critical to prevent further absorption into your building materials and to begin the drying process. Fast water extraction limits damage.

2. Advanced Moisture Detection

Once the visible water is gone, we use specialized tools like infrared cameras and moisture meters. These help us pinpoint exactly where moisture is hiding, even deep within walls or under flooring. Identifying all wet areas is key to preventing future problems like mold. Precise moisture mapping guides our drying efforts.

3. Controlled Drying and Dehumidification

We set up a network of high-speed air movers and industrial dehumidifiers. These machines work together to accelerate evaporation and remove moisture from the air. We carefully monitor humidity levels and airflow to ensure materials dry evenly and safely, preventing warping or deterioration. Controlled drying protocols are essential.

4. Containment and Air Quality Management

If necessary, we’ll use containment barriers to isolate affected areas. This prevents the spread of moisture and potential contaminants. Air scrubbers can also be employed to filter the air, removing airborne particles and odors. Maintaining air quality is part of a healthy restoration. We focus on your home’s safety.

5. Inspection and Rebuilding

After drying, we conduct a final inspection to confirm all moisture has been eliminated. We then address any necessary repairs, such as replacing damaged drywall, flooring, or baseboards. Our goal is to return your home to its pre-incident condition. Restoring your home is our priority.

Warning Signs You Need Sprinkler System Water Damage Restoration

Catching sprinkler system water damage early can save you significant time and money. Ignoring these signs often leads to more extensive and costly repairs down the line, including structural damage and mold infestations. Pay close attention to what your home is telling you. Early detection is key to a smoother recovery.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p or musty smell, especially near your sprinkler system lines or in lower levels of your home, is a strong indicator of hidden moisture. This odor often signals that water has been sitting long enough to encourage mold or mildew growth. Investigate unusual smells promptly.

Visible Water Stains or Puddles

Obvious water pooling on floors, walls, or ceilings is the most direct sign. Even small, recurring puddles or damp spots around your sprinkler system’s access points shouldn’t be ignored. Address visible water before it spreads.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per

Moisture behind your walls can cause paint to blister and wallpaper to peel away from the surface. This is a clear sign that water has infiltrated the building materials and is causing them to degrade. Check for wall damage indicating hidden moisture.

Soft or Warped Flooring and Subflooring

If your carpets feel unusually soft or squishy, or if hardwood floors start to warp or cup, it means they’ve absorbed significant moisture. This can compromise the integrity of your flooring and the structure beneath it. Inspect your flooring for signs of saturation.

Changes in Drywall or Plaster

Drywall can become soft, crumbly, or even sag when repeatedly exposed to water. You might notice discoloration or a spongy texture if you gently press on affected areas. This damage requires professional assessment and likely replacement. Assess drywall integrity carefully.

Increased Humidity Levels Indoors

If your home feels unusually humid, sticky, or if condensation is forming on windows, it could be due to an ongoing water intrusion problem. Your HVAC system may also struggle to keep up. Monitor indoor humidity for unusual spikes.

Sprinkler System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small puddle near an easily accessible sprinkler valve after a test run. Yes No Quickly absorb with towels.
Widespread water on basement carpet from a burst mainline. No Yes Requires specialized extraction equipment.
Damp spots on a wall near an outdoor sprinkler head. Maybe Yes Hidden leaks can cause extensive damage behind walls.
Musty smell in a room with no visible water. No Yes Indicates hidden moisture and potential mold growth.
Water damage affecting multiple rooms or floors. No Yes Needs coordinated drying and containment efforts.
Concerns about mold growth or structural integrity. No Yes Requires professional assessment and remediation.

While minor spills can often be handled with basic cleanup, anything more significant, especially if it involves hidden moisture or potential structural impact, demands professional attention. DIY efforts often fall short when it comes to thorough drying and preventing secondary damage. Trusting the professionals ensures complete water mitigation.

Sprinkler System Water Damage Restoration Cost In Peachtree Corners, GA

The cost for sprinkler system water damage restoration in Peachtree Corners, GA, varies greatly depending on the extent of the water intrusion, the size of the affected area, and the materials damaged. These figures are estimates, and a precise quote requires an on-site inspection. Understanding costs upfront helps homeowners prepare.

Service Aspect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ction (Initial) $500 – $2,500 Volume of water, accessibility, and area size.
Moisture Detection & Assessment $200 – $700 Complexity of the structure and number of affected zones.
Controlled Drying (Air Movers & Dehumidifiers) $1,000 – $4,000+ (per week) Duration needed to reach dry standards, number of units required.
Containment & Air Filtration $300 – $1,500 Size of area to contain, type of filtration equipment used.
Minor Structural Repairs (e.g., drywall patch) $200 – $1,000 per section Material costs, labor time, and complexity of the repair.
Odor Removal & Antimicrobial Treatment $300 – $1,200 Severity of odor, size of affected area, and treatment methods.

Common Questions About Sprinkler System Water Damage Restoration

My sprinkler system leaked a little, is it okay to just dry it with fans?

While fans can help with surface drying, they are often insufficient for addressing deeper moisture. Water can seep into subflooring, wall cavities, and insulation, creating a hidden breeding ground for mold. Professional drying equipment is designed to extract moisture from these areas. We use advanced techniques to ensure your home is dried thoroughly and safely, preventing long-term issues that fans alone can’t solve.

How quickly do I need to deal with sprinkler water damage?

You need to act immediately. The longer water sits, the more damage it causes. Within 24-48 hours, mold can begin to grow, and structural materials can start to degrade. Swift professional intervention is critical to minimize damage and reduce restoration costs. We’re equipped to respond quickly to your emergency.

Will sprinkler water damage cause health problems?

Yes, it can. Stagnant water from sprinkler systems can harbor bacteria and, more significantly, lead to mold growth. Mold spores can cause respiratory issues, allergic reactions, and other health problems for occupants. Addressing water damage promptly is vital for your family’s health. We take measures to neutralize contaminants and ensure a healthy environment.

What kind of equipment do you use to dry out my home after a sprinkler leak?

We utilize a range of specialized equipment, including high-powered water extractors, industrial-grade air movers, and commercial dehumidifiers. We also employ advanced mo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to detect and track hidden water. This technology allows us to create a controlled drying environment and ensure complete moisture removal. Our equipment gets the job done efficiently.

How can I prevent future water damage from my sprinkler system?

Regular maintenance is key. Have your sprinkler system inspected annually by a qualified technician to check for leaks, proper function, and potential issues. Ensure your outdoor lines are properly drained before winter if you live in an area with freezing temperatures.
